
Understanding Custom Cylinder Heads
Custom cylinder heads, also known as custom-built or performance cylinder heads, are specifically designed to meet unique engine requirements. Unlike off-the-shelf heads, they allow engineers and builders to optimize port size and shape, valve angles, and combustion chamber geometry. They can be made from a variety of materials, including aluminum, titanium, and cast iron, depending on the intended application.
These heads are precision-engineered for performance, durability, and efficiency. Engine builders consider factors such as engine displacement, compression ratio, intended use, and power goals when designing custom cylinder heads. This flexibility makes them suitable for high-performance racing, industrial engines, marine applications, and even legacy or discontinued engines.
How Custom Cylinder Heads Increase Performance?
The primary advantage of custom cylinder heads is their ability to increase engine horsepower and efficiency. By optimizing airflow, combustion efficiency, and cylinder filling, these heads allow engines to generate more power. Common modifications include larger intake and exhaust ports, reshaped combustion chambers, precision-machined valve seats, and high-performance valve guides.
Additional performance upgrades, such as high-lift camshafts, stiffer valve springs, or larger valves, can be integrated into the design. These enhancements not only improve horsepower but also deliver better throttle response and fuel efficiency, giving your engine a significant performance boost.
Materials and Design Considerations
Choosing the right material is crucial. Aluminum cylinder heads are lightweight and provide excellent heat dissipation, making them ideal for racing and high-performance vehicles. Titanium heads offer extreme strength with minimal weight, suitable for demanding applications. Cast iron heads provide durability and cost-effectiveness, perfect for industrial or heavy-duty engines.
Efficient cylinder head design also requires careful attention to port shapes, combustion chamber configuration, and minimizing restrictions in intake and exhaust paths. The best designs balance airflow, compression ratio, and valve timing for the specific engine and application.
Applications of Custom Cylinder Heads
Custom cylinder heads are versatile. For racing and high-performance vehicles, they maximize airflow and torque. Industrial engines and generators benefit from durable, heavy-duty construction for continuous operation. Marine engines gain improved cooling and corrosion resistance, while legacy or discontinued engines can receive reproduced or upgraded heads to replace unavailable OEM parts.
Cost and Investment Considerations
Custom cylinder heads represent a significant investment, with prices varying depending on design complexity, materials, machining precision, and the reputation of the builder. For a typical V8 engine, a set may range from $2,000 to $6,000 or more. Specialized applications, such as racing or extreme industrial use, can cost even higher.
While the cost may be substantial, the performance gains, improved efficiency, and long-term reliability often justify the investment, especially for applications where standard heads cannot meet the requirements.
How to Choose the Right Custom Cylinder Head?
When selecting a custom cylinder head, consider your engine type, performance goals, and budget. Determine whether you need a moderate power increase or a major performance boost. Decide on the material and design features suited for your application, and consult experienced engine builders to ensure your custom heads meet your specifications.
